WebA single Ethernet run with good quality cable should be fine up to 100 meters. If you can go around the perimeter and end up under that length, it should still work. Mind you, at that length, you may have to crimp your own ends on the cable. Finding a 150ft outdoor cable with ends already on it isn't a challenge, and should cost $55 or $60.
